Some costs matter more than others (e.g. in decision making marginal cost and opportunity cost matter, but average cost and sunk costs don’t).

Is cheap foreign labour a danger to high-wage economies?
No: we short term lost jobs, but we get to buy cheap products, produce high value products and create better jobs.
